What Arjunan Per Paththu is about
Arjunan Per Paththu opens with the kind of trauma that doesn't announce itself — lightning strikes, parents gone, and a young man left standing in a village in Madurai with nowhere to go but forward. Arjunan makes his way to Chennai, finds work at a kayalang shop, falls in love, and does everything right: saves his money, plans carefully, marries the woman he loves. He buys an old Tata Ace with everything he's saved, believing it's his first real step toward becoming an entrepreneur. That belief doesn't last long. The vehicle is a wreck, the sale was a scam, and Arjunan slowly realizes he's not alone — dozens of buyers have been cheated the same way. What starts as a personal story of grief and ambition quietly transforms into something larger: a collective fight for accountability in the murky world of used-vehicle trading. No capes. No revenge fantasy. Just a man who decides enough is enough.

Why Arjunan Per Paththu stands out from other Tamil crime dramas
What's striking is how ordinary the crime at the center of this film is. There's no cartel, no kingpin, no dramatic shootout. The fraud here is the kind that happens every day — a seller who knows a vehicle is broken, a buyer who trusts too much, paperwork that obscures more than it reveals. That mundane specificity is what gives Arjunan Per Paththu its edge over more stylized crime films.
The film's emotional architecture rests on Arjunan's arc from grief-stricken migrant to reluctant activist, and the transition is handled without the usual shortcuts. He doesn't become a hero because he's exceptional — he becomes one because he's stubborn, and because the alternative is accepting that the loss of his savings means nothing. There's a scene (early in the second act, by most accounts) where Arjunan confronts the vehicle dealer and is laughed off. That moment — small, humiliating, entirely believable — is the film's real turning point, not any dramatic confrontation later on.
The collective dimension of the story also sets it apart. Arjunan gathering other cheated buyers isn't played as a triumphant montage. It's slow, awkward, and occasionally funny in the way that real organizing tends to be. People are scared. Some don't want the trouble.
